Hello,
some trouble trying to make dri works with my card. It is a S3 savage 4 card with 16384 k video memory.
Suggestions about what to do (recompile, re-configure anything) could be useful..
I include logs here (I follow dri.freedesktop.org steps on troubleshooting):

  lsmod lists these modules : savage, drm, via_agp, agpart, i2c_savage4, i2c_algo_bit, i2c_viapro, i2c_core
   
  All these with:
   
  - Slackware 11.0, kernel 2.6.17.13, X.org 6.9.0, savage_dri.so driver downloaded from snapshots (savage-20060403-linux.i386.tar.bz2),
  OpenGL renderer string: Mesa DRI Savage4 20050829 AGP 1x x86/MMX/SSE
   
  the computer hangs with glxgears after a little movement of mechanics.
   
  I tried also with:
  - Foresight 1.0, kernel 2.6.19.2, X.org 7.1.1
   
  glxinfo complains : "libGL warning: 3D driver claims to not support visual 0x4B", so does glxgears but then hangs.
  and:
   
  - Zenwalk, kernel 2.6.18.6, X.org 7.1.1
   
  launching glxgears appears a black window (but no hangs).
